Socceroo Harry Souttar joins Leicester in Australian record transfer
Harry Souttar has become Australia’s most expensive soccer player, signing for English Premier League side Leicester City from second-tier Stoke City for $26m. The Socceroo becomes the only Australian currently playing in England’s top-flight and is likely to go straight into the Foxes team. His fee eclipses the initial $14m Huddersfield paid Manchester City for Aaron Mooy in 2007. It pushes Mark Viduka’s $10m move from Celtic to Leeds in 2000 …
